About this ebook
Get to grips with a new technology, understand what it is and what it can do for you, and then get to work with the most important features and tasks. This short, focused guide is a great way to get stated with writing MDX queries. New developers can use this book as a reference for how to use functions and the syntax of a query as well as how to use Calculated Members and Named Sets. This book is great for new developers who want to learn the MDX query language from scratch and install SQL Server 2012 with Analysis Services.
